About the role

NorthEast Sportsfield-Rec is seeking an experienced Construction Sports Field Technician to join our team. We specialize in building high-quality baseball fields and athletic facilities.

Responsibilities

  • Planning daily and weekly work schedules
  • Ensuring all work is completed according to project specifications and drawings
  • Leading and working alongside laborers, providing direction and support
  • Tracking crew hours and completing daily job reports
  • Maintaining responsibility for on-site safety and compliance
  • Coinciding with general contractors, superintendents, and project managers
  • Attending weekly job meetings as needed
  • Conducting regular safety meetings with the crew

Requirements

  • High school diploma required (2-year degree in turf or horticulture preferred)
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in sports field construction
  • Experience with:
    • Natural field construction
    • Fence and backstop installation
    • Layout, dugouts, bleachers, and concrete work
    • Equipment operation (dozers, graders, laser equipment, excavators, etc.)
  • Ability to read and interpret drawings, grading plans, and elevations
  • Strong communication skills, including working with clients and project teams
  • Comfortable working independently when needed
  • Valid driver’s license with a good driving record
  • Hydraulic license (or ability to obtain within 60 days)
  • CDL Class A or B preferred
  • DOT Medical Card required
  • OSHA 10 or 30 certification required for public works projects
  • Experience using mobile work order/job tracking software
  • Willingness to travel and stay overnight for 5+ days when required
  • ASBA and/or NPCAI certification is a plus
